With its roots in the Andes Cordillera, Conjuros blends jazz and blues into South American folklore. Los Chamanes are rendering powerful, funky, soulful interpretations of compositions by the greatest authors of Chile and Argentina, such as Victor Jara, Violeta Parra, Congreso y Peteco Carabajal, as well as the prose of their own member and composer, Ricardo Cuevas. They seem to have found the exact place where people from all walks of life and ages meet and share: poetry in all its forms. They tell of the earth and its inhabitants, of deep and simple things, with nostalgia and joy. There is not a meaningless song there, even the instrumentals speak.
Think Silvio Rodriguez meets Lila Downs meets Inti-Illimani meets Congreso. But there is no doubt that Los Chamanes are who you meet here.
“As a southern wind, Los Chamanes come to soothe our ears and heart”
- Claudia Acuña

Con sus raíces en la Cordillera de los Andes, Conjuros mezcla jazz y blues con folklore Suramericano. Los Chamanes entregan interpretaciones poderosas, rítmicas y conmovedoras de canciones de los mas grandes autores de Chile y Argentina, como Victor Jara, Violeta Parra, Congreso y Peteco Carabajal, y también la prosa de su propio autor, Ricardo Cuevas. Parece que encontraran el lugar exacto donde la gente de cualquier origen, estilo o edad puede juntarse y compartir: poesía en todas sus formas. Hablan de la tierra y de sus habitantes, de cosas sencillas y profundas, con nostalgia y alegría. Cada canción tiene sentido, aun los temas instrumentales cuentan.
Imaginen un encuentro de Silvio Rodríguez con Lila Downs con Inti-Illimani con Congreso. Pero quién hallan aquí sin duda son: Los Chamanes.
“Como el viento del Sur vienen Los Chamanes a complacer nuestros oidos y nuestro corazón”
- Claudia Acuña
